Course programme
This course which has recently been modernised by SQA, develops higher level skills and knowledge in software development and technical support, as well as developing
core skills. It is suitable for individuals wanting to further their studies
from NQ Computing or to develop a career in Computing or Information
Technology.
Two academic years. You will need to attend College for 6 hours per week, plus
commit to undertake further self-study of at least 3 hours per week.
You will gain knowledge and expertise in subjects such as information technology,
computer operating systems, programming, digital forensics, application
software, working within a project team and network technologies. A final
Graded Unit examination will assess the skills you have developed throughout
the course.
1 Higher Grade pass (Grade C or above) plus 2 Standard Grade passes at Credit level, or an appropriate range of SQA units at Intermediate 2 and Higher level.
